繁体   English   中英

如何在同一个NetBeans(7.3)项目中一起调试JavaScript和PHP?

[英]How to debug JavaScript and PHP together in the same NetBeans (7.3) project?

在我的第一步中,我使用这种不合理的方式,如下所述:

  1. 创建一个HTML5项目来调试JavaScript代码。
  2. 创建最终的PHP项目,已经测试了JS代码,我调试服务器端。

所以我想知道是否有更聪明的方法吗?
例如:创建一个独特的项目,并在本机NetBeans JavaScript调试器和(PHP) XDebug之间切换。

对于Chrome中的JavaScript调试,您应该使用官方NetBeans Connector扩展。

以下是有关如何使用NetBeans + Chrome + NetBeans Connector调试JavaScript代码的示例:

在HTML5应用程序中调试和测试JavaScript https://netbeans.org/kb/docs/webclient/html5-js-support.html

创建新项目后,您应该“确认在工具栏的下拉列表中选择了带NetBeans连接器的Chrome”

确认在工具栏的下拉列表中选中了Chrome with NetBeans Connector

(在我的NetBeans中看起来像这样:
NetBeans连接器

在某些行之前放置一些断点:

JS代码断点

然后点击Run。 点击Run后,你会看到一个黄色的警告栏,看起来有点像这样,说“ ”NetBeans Connector“正在调试这个标签 ”:

“NetBeans Connector”正在调试此选项卡

现在不要打开Chrome的内置Web检查器工具栏(或者您会收到警告,这会破坏NetBeans中的常规调试过程)。

现在您可以在NetBeans中调试JavaScript代码,代码将在Chrome中运行。 您应该打开Window→Debugging→Variables面板来检查变量。

或鼠标悬停在某些项目上:

NetBeans JS代码调试;变量


关于调试PHP代码,这里有一些相关的官方文章:

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M